  • Good resources to use when starting PT/PTA school
    Complete Anatomy -is a really great app for anatomy. I had a few classmates say they kept using this beyond anatomy, including to help them study for the boards (NPTE). It allows you to zoom in on specific muscles, nerves, vasculature, etc... It does a whole lot more and it is really helpful if you are a visual learner. Source: almost 2 years ago
